Croatia Seeks Stronger Ties with Azerbaijan on Independence Day

Baku: Andrej Plenkovic, the Prime Minister of the Republic of Croatia, has extended his congratulations to Azerbaijan on its Independence Day, expressing aspirations for strengthened bilateral relations. Plenkovic conveyed his message on behalf of the Croatian government and in a personal capacity, highlighting the importance of dialogue, mutual respect, and cooperation.

According to Azerbaijan State News Agency, Plenkovic emphasized Croatia's interest in enhancing cooperation with Azerbaijan, particularly in trade and energy security. He noted the substantial potential for economic development between the two nations, advocating for increased collaboration between Croatian and Azerbaijani companies and mutual investments. Plenkovic expressed confidence in the deepening friendship and strategic partnership between the two countries, aiming for benefits to both nations.

Plenkovic concluded with best wishes to Azerbaijan and reassurances of his highest consideration, marking a commitment to developing robust ties in the future.
